This article explores the important role of a lawyer in the legal system and how they contribute to ensuring justice is served. A lawyer plays a crucial role in the legal system by representing clients in various legal matters. They are responsible for providing legal advice, drafting legal documents, and representing clients in court. Lawyers are also advocates for their clients, ensuring that their rights are protected and that they receive a fair trial. One of the key responsibilities of a lawyer is to conduct thorough research and analysis of legal issues to provide the best possible representation for their clients. They must stay up-to-date on changes in the law and be prepared to argue cases effectively in court. Lawyers must also possess strong communication skills to effectively negotiate on behalf of their clients and present their arguments persuasively. In addition to representing clients in court, lawyers also play a crucial role in alternative dispute resolution methods such as mediation and arbitration. These methods can help clients resolve legal disputes outside of the courtroom, saving time and money in the process. Overall, lawyers are essential to the functioning of the legal system and play a vital role in ensuring that justice is served. Their dedication to upholding the law and advocating for their clients makes them indispensable members of the legal profession.
